7 August 2007 A new global GIS architecture based on STQIE model
Chengqi Cheng, Li Guan, Shide Guo, Guoliang Pu, Min Sun
Author Affiliations +
Abstract
Global GIS is a system, which supports the huge data process and the global direct manipulation on global grid based on spheroid or ellipsoid surface. A new Global GIS architecture based on STQIE model is designed in this paper, according to the computer cluster theory, the space-time integration technology and the virtual real technology. There is four-level protocol framework and three-layer data management pattern of Global GIS based on organization, management and publication of spatial information in this architecture. In this paper a global 3D prototype system is developed taking advantage of C++ language according to the above thought. This system integrated the simulation system with GIS, and supported display of multi-resolution DEM, image and multi-dimensional static or dynamic 3D objects.
